SwasthaNetra – Its Maintenance by GrithaTarpana

Abstract

Among Panchagnanendriya, Netra is given prime importance as it is concerned with rupa grahana. Vision is important to human survival without which day and night matters nothing to one’s life. Netra is agni mahabuta pradhana and this agni helps in rupa grahana. Further, it is said that intake of pitta prakopaka aahara will increase mala in shira which gets lodged in different parts of netra and cause netra roga. In the context of pathyapatya of netra, it is said that gritha is the best sneha. Also Acharya Sharangdhara mentions that tarpana kriyakalpa gives tarpana to the netra. Though netra is agni mahabuta pradhana it is sheeta saatmya. As gritha and tarpana gives sheetata to netra we can say that these are best suitable to maintain the swastata of the netra. In modern parlance, it is mentioned that intra ocular drug administration is the best way to maintain eyes healthy and to treat eye diseases. With the above given information, in this paper an attempt is made to explain the efficacy of grihta tarpana and its mode of absorption into the netra in maintaining swastha netra.
